> >> > Make VMS_ARRAY_OF_POINTER cope with null pointers. Previously the reward
> >> > for trying to migrate an array with some null pointers in it was an
> >> > illegal memory access, that is a swift and painless death of the
> >> > process. Let's make vmstate cope with this scenario at least for
> >> > pointers to structs. The general approach is when we encounter a null
> >> > pointer (element) instead of following the pointer to save/load the data
> >> > behind it we save/load a placeholder. This way we can detect if we
> >> > expected a null pointer at the load side but not null data was saved
> >> > instead. Sadly all other error scenarios are not detected by this scheme
> >> > (and would require the usage of the JSON meta data).
> >> > 
> >> > Limitations: Does not work for pointers to primitives.
> > Hmm is this needed - I mean could you do this just by giving the vmsd
> > that defines the children of the array a '.needed' that tests if their
> > pointer is NULL?
> > 
> > 
> 
> I do not think so: .needed is basically for subsections (also used
> in migration/savevm.c via the exported vmstate_save_needed function),
> and .field_exists is also no use for this (AFAIU). Have also tried
> just to be sure, it did not work for me. 

Hmm yes you're right; I thought .needed was more general; and
field_exists does seem to be too late.

> If I did not convince you, a bit of a code proving me wrong would be
> highly appreciated.

Well, here's some untested code (on top of your code with the test);
it seems simple (if it works!)
